ICAW 2025, May 4-10: Sustainable Cities Begin with Compost
This theme was chosen to highlight composting in all kinds of communities at any scale--from the backyard home composter, to community composters, to large-scale facilities, to all those who recognize the many benefits of using compost on our soil.

This year, IFSCC’s ICAW adventures took place across 13 counties in Illinois, with thousands of people attending a variety of informative programs, events, and activities that provided opportunities to learn about the importance and benefits of composting and utilizing compost. These programs also included fun events, such as farm festivals, storytimes in gardens and at libraries, games, crafts, plant sales and giveaways, compost givebacks, farmers' markets with special booths and displays, compost demonstrations, tours, and more. In addition to compost and composting, the week included information sharing and conversations surrounding all the interrelated issues and topics of soil health, conservation, wasted food reduction and diversion, how to grow healthy food, combating climate change, hunger, and more.
